## v5.2.0 — Signing key rotation (Tallyward ledger)

Welcome, new folks — please read carefully. As part of our scheduled security review, we rotated the signing key used to seal entries in Tallyward, the loyalty-points ledger. Every ledger checkpoint from sequence 48,200 onward is signed with the new key; earlier checkpoints remain valid under the archived key, documented in the key history page. Verification tooling was updated in the same release, so no manual steps are needed. For completeness, the active signing key is recorded here:

rollout seal: bky4_x7Gc

The nightly export to the Ostvale partner drop is driven entirely by environment variables on the transfer host. Required: `SFTP_DROP_DIR=/outbound/ostvale`, `SFTP_RETRY_MAX=5`, `SFTP_SCHEDULE=0230`. Files land as `.part` and are renamed on completion; partners poll every 15 minutes. If a transfer stalls, check the retry counter before restarting the daemon. Support should never edit the schedule without a change ticket. The final required variable authenticates the transfer user, and it goes on the next line of the env file.

sealed setting: VAULT_KEY20=c8ea1e419912889df6b4

# Runbook: Static-Analysis Baseline Refresh

When Lintharbor reports a flood of pre-existing findings, the baseline file is stale. Support can trigger a refresh without engineering: run the refresh job on Jobspire, which regenerates baseline.lint and uploads it to the Findex store. Do not edit the file by hand; hand edits break the checksum and the scanner falls back to full-repo mode. The refresh job authenticates to Findex with the key shown below.

service key, fawip-bajef: kto11_Qt5wZK9vdNC

MEMO — Kettling Depot Receiving

Uniform sets for the new Kettling depot arrive Wednesday via Ashgrove courier: 40 boxes, sorted by size, manifest attached to box one. Check the count at the dock before signing; shortages go straight to stores, not the courier. The hand-over instruction the courier will follow is set out below.

drop instructions, tafof-baguf: the holmir gilox courier leaves the sormir ulaok holdor ledger at gate 5596 under passcode 257343